From c74636694956af8e2fe74bbeddf72891b9b5cfb1 Mon Sep 17 00:00:00 2001 From: Richard Henderson Date: Thu, 24 Feb 2005 01:24:17 -0800 Subject: [PATCH] re PR middle-end/18902 (Naive (default) complex division algorithm) PR middle-end/18902 * c-opts.c (c_common_post_options): Set flag_complex_method to 2 for c99. * common.opt (fcx-limited-range): New. * opts.c (set_fast_math_flags): Set flag_cx_limited_range. * toplev.c (flag_complex_method): Initialize to 1. (process_options): Set flag_complex_method to 0 if flag_cx_limited_range. * doc/invoke.texi (-fcx-limited-range): New.
